The Artesia City Council approved a water conservation ordinance Tuesday on a 6-0 vote. The ordinance has been repeatedly brought up in meetings over the past months after being revised several times in committee, and the council was finally able to find a plan they were satisfied with Tuesday.
“This ordinance has taken a great deal of time, which it should,” said Mayor Phillip Burch. “This is one of the more important ordinances that we have passed in the last few years.” … For the rest of the story, subscribe in print and on the web.
